The size of Merimbula is approximately 18.3 square kilometres. It has 14 parks covering nearly 8.6% of total area. The population of Merimbula in 2016 was 3544 people. By 2021 the population was 3821 showing a population growth of 7.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Merimbula is 60-69 years. Households in Merimbula are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Merimbula work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 63.00% of the homes in Merimbula were owner-occupied compared with 58.30% in 2016.
